The girl’s state high school soccer tournament opens today in Muscatine. Third-ranked Bettendorf opens with a match against Iowa City West. Bettendorf and coach Todd Hornaday will be looking to avenge a first round loss to West last year. He says they’re essentially the same team as last year. Hornaday says while last year’s match ended one-to-nothing, West dominated play. He thinks it will be a closer match this year.Bettendorf has yielded just one goal the entire season and Hornaday says limiting the breakdowns on defense will be a key.Hornaday says all the teams at the state tournament are solid defensively so his club will need to take advantage of scoring opportunities.
